On the latest Pipeline Podcast, Jim Callis, Sam Dykstra, Jonathan Mayo and Jason Ratliff discuss the Top 100 Prospects list that MLB Pipeline unveiled last Friday. They discuss why Orioles shortstop Jackson Holliday was a relatively easy choice for the No. 1 spot and the immediate impact of what could be a historic 2023 Draft class. Other topics included players who made huge jumps, picks to do the same this season and which teams had the most representation on the list. Then the guys answered 10 questions from listeners about prospects who did and didn't make the Top 100.
